Summary
The Senior Portfolio Manager proactively manages assigned commercial and corporate loan portfolio by monitoring performance, identifying trends, and escalating material changes. Partnering closely with Relationship Managers, this role leads the structuring, underwriting, origination, renewal, and servicing of credits; independently prioritizes requests, assesses risk and risk ratings, recommends optimal credit structures, and prepares and presents credit proposals. The position provides ongoing analytical and credit oversight, including annual reviews, covenant compliance monitoring, and financial statement collection and analysis, to support the growth of a high-quality, profitable portfolio and long-term client relationships. The Senior Portfolio Manager balances competing priorities while ensuring adherence to policy, risk appetite, and sound credit discipline. The role collaborates with Credit Analysts and other associates and provides guidance and mentoring to junior team members
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
Leads the underwriting and ongoing servicing of commercial loan portfolios for clients with annual revenues from over $30 million to $1 billion
Proactively identifies credit weaknesses / trends and alerts management to deterioration
Collaborates with RM to prioritize new credit requests, renewals, and reviews
Provides risk ratings and recommends appropriate credit structure
Identifies policy exceptions
Prepares approval, commitment, proposal document, and participates in documentation process including the identification of covenants and other key provisions
Participates in customer meetings to discuss alternative credit structures and to clarify any questions. Also interacts with clients during due diligence and finalizing credit package
Serves as a secondary customer contact to the Relationship Manager

About Us
First Horizon Corporation is a leading regional financial services company, dedicated to helping our clients, communities and associates unlock their full potential with capital and counsel. Headquartered in Memphis, TN, the banking subsidiary First Horizon Bank operates in 12 states across the southern U.S. The Company and its subsidiaries offer commercial, private banking, consumer, small business, wealth and trust management, retail brokerage, capital markets, fixed income, and mortgage banking services.
